golang开源分布式调度系统

admin 2025-01-21 00:01:20 编程 来源:ZONE.CI 全球网 0 阅读模式

随着互联网的快速发展,对于高效调度和资源管理的需求越来越迫切。在这个背景下,分布式调度系统应运而生,成为许多企业处理大规模任务的首选工具。Go语言作为一门开发效率高、性能优异的编程语言,自然也发展出了一系列开源分布式调度系统。本文将介绍其中一种代表性的系统。

系统介绍

这个开源分布式调度系统是基于Go语言开发的,旨在为企业提供高效的任务调度和资源管理解决方案。它以简洁高效的设计理念为基础,利用Go语言的并发特性和轻量级线程模型,实现了强大且可扩展的功能。

特点一:强大的任务调度能力

该系统具备灵活的任务调度功能,支持各种类型的任务调度,如定时任务、计划任务等。用户可以通过简单的配置实现任务的调度和执行,同时还能方便地管理任务的依赖关系和执行顺序。通过对任务执行结果进行监控和收集,系统能够及时反馈任务执行情况,帮助用户实时了解任务状态。

特点二:高效的资源管理

该系统通过智能资源调度算法,实现了高效的资源管理。用户可以根据需求配置不同类型的资源,并设置相应的优先级和限制条件。系统会根据资源的可用性和任务的需求进行智能分配,确保资源的合理使用和任务的高效执行。同时,系统还支持资源的动态扩展和收缩,能够根据实际需求自动调整资源的分配。

特点三:可扩展的架构

该系统采用了模块化的架构设计,支持多种插件和扩展接口,方便用户根据实际需求进行功能扩展。用户可以根据自己的业务场景,选择合适的插件和接口进行集成,满足不同的需求。同时,系统还支持集群部署和水平扩展,能够处理大规模任务和高并发请求,保证系统的稳定性和可靠性。

通过以上几个重要特点,这个开源的分布式调度系统为企业提供了一个高效、灵活、可扩展的解决方案。它不仅能有效提高任务的执行效率和资源的利用率,还能简化任务调度和管理的复杂性。对于那些需要处理大规模任务和复杂资源管理的企业来说,这个系统无疑是一个不可或缺的利器。

weinxin
版权声明
本站原创文章转载请注明文章出处及链接,谢谢合作!
golang开源分布式调度系统 编程

golang开源分布式调度系统

随着互联网的快速发展,对于高效调度和资源管理的需求越来越迫切。在这个背景下,分布式调度系统应运而生,成为许多企业处理大规模任务的首选工具。Go语言作为一门开发效
golang切片里面冒号 编程

golang切片里面冒号

开发Golang的切片(slicing)是一项非常强大和常用的技术,在处理数组和列表时特别有用。切片提供了一种简单和灵活的方式来访问数组或切片中的元素。本文将介
meyers golang 编程

meyers golang

Go语言是Google开发的一种编译型、快速、可靠的通用编程语言,它具有灵活的语法和强大的并发支持。作为一名专业的Go开发者,我深深被这门语言的简洁性和高效性所
golang何时创建系统线程 编程

golang何时创建系统线程

在Golang中,系统线程的创建是一个非常重要的话题。系统线程是操作系统对于程序运行的最基本支持,它负责调度和执行程序的功能。在Golang中,系统线程的创建是
评论:0   参与:  0